University Of Texas At El Paso is located in El Paso, TX and the Gymnastics program competes in the Conference USA conference.
University Of Texas At El Paso does offer athletic scholarships for Gymnastics. Need-based and academic scholarships are available for student-athletes. Athletic scholarships are available for NCAA Division I, NCAA Division II, NAIA and NJCAA. On average, 34% of all student-athletes receive athletic scholarships.
